Finally got my 700-4 somewhat cleaned up from the abuse at the RRB Takeover and noticed I beat the factory rock guards, slides, tubing or whatever the correct term is up pretty nicely. Most of this was from going down Widow Maker. Any body got any good suggestions for somewhat straightening back out and some aftermarket guards to prevent this in the future? The tubing is dinged pretty good but my main concern is the tubing is bent out of alignment up approximately 1/4” to 3/8” on both sides. The passenger door now runs slightly on the bottom of the door jamb. Any thoughts?

Pics please, if it the end of the tubing behind the B puller you can use a high lift jack to push it down. Put the base one the running board or tube, and hook the jack under the B puller crossbar atheon the shoulder belt connection point.
